Rough ideals based on ideal determined varieties

The paper is devoted to concern a relationship between rough set theory and universal algebra. Notions of lower and upper rough approximations on an algebraic structure induced by an ideal are introduced and some of their properties are studied. Approximate $n-$ideal amenability of module extension Banach algebras

Let $mathcal{A}$ be a Banach algebra and $X$ be a Banach $mathcal{A}-$bimodule. We study the notion of approximate $n-$ideal amenability for module extension Banach algebras $mathcal{A}oplus X$. First, we describe the structure of ideals of this kind of algebras and we present the necessary and sufficient conditions for a module extension Banach algebra to be approximately n-ideally amenable.

The nonstationary ideal in the ℛmax extension

The forcing construction Pmax, invented by W. Hugh Woodin, produces a model whose collection of subsets of ω1 is in some sense maximal. In this paper we study the Boolean algebra induced by the nonstationary ideal on ω1 in this model. Among other things we show that the induced quotient does not have a simply definable form.
